The problem with Lacrosse Reference strength of schedule,

they’re projecting SoS forward.
Schedule strength changes by year end depending on if a
team gets, say, to the conference finals or even to the NCAAs.

Its a seriously flawed measure.
But, it doesn’t take any fancy analysis to see that the Tigers
have one of the best schedules in the country this year.

That’s great since this gives the Tigers two ways into
the tournament.
